Default when the 50 opened up

We were working with this APC Group. And One day we took a water fall of fire from a tree line , The APCs were behind us about 50 yards. , When that fireing started , I thought, well today, I die. The APCs came on line behind us and opened up with there 50s. As soon as I heard that Dat,Dat, Dat from the 50 I knew we were going to be ok. LT said move back, Didn't have to tell me twice. When we got behind the APC he says every one check for holes, He was talking about holes in us. Zero in me, thank you very much. Whoooo Whooo , Live another day. I beleive they were some Cav unit. ,,, Thanks, By the way.
